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Langley Mill to Little Sutton start from as little as £11.20

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Langley Mill to Little Sutton are available for £49.50 one way, or £74.50 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ities at Langley Mill Station

Langley Mill Station is equipped to cater to the basic needs of passengers. While it lacks a ticket office, convenient ticket machines are on hand to facilitate purchasing your train tickets. Unfortunately, ticket machines aren’t accessible, and the station does not offer the facility to collect tickets bought online. For assistance, the station features customer help points and maintains CCTV for passenger safety. However, certain comforts such as waiting rooms, restrooms, and refreshment facilities are absent, reminding travellers to plan ahead. The station also includes an induction loop to aid those with hearing impairments.

Getting Around: Accessibility and Support

Langley Mill Station is categorized as having a ‘Step-Free’ access Level B, which means that some parts of the station are accessible - notably, Platform 1 can be reached via a ramp though Platform 2 does not offer step-free access. Although the station does not provide facilities like ticket barriers or a dedicated accessible toilet, customer help points are available for additional assistance. It's also important to note that there is no dedicated provision for cyclists and no spaces available for bicycle storage.

Facilities at Little Sutton

As a modest-sized station, Little Sutton offers key facilities essential for a smooth travel experience. Despite not having a ticket office, it serves travelers efficiently with ticket machines to purchase or collect tickets for your journey. For those looking for accessibility, rest assured the station has accessible ticket machines and an induction loop.

The station has a reasonable degree of step-free access. While considered Category B, it's advised to double-check the access details, especially if you're in need of assistance. Unfortunately, the station doesn't have waiting rooms or refreshment facilities, so plan accordingly if you anticipate waiting time.
